Overview of Scheduling in ROB-EX

Scheduling in ROB-EX is the same as automated planning, where the orders and operations are placed on optimal resources according to a scheduling strategy.

There are two kinds of scheduling in ROB-EX:

  • Scheduling and rescheduling of one or more orders, where operations of the order are placed on optimal resources.
  • Bottleneck sort of orders with bottleneck operations, where one or more operations are bottlenecks, and the previous or following operations get rescheduled around the bottleneck.

Both can be done in forward or backward direction, and several settings define how the scheduling is done. The direction and settings are controlled in the Scheduling strategy window.

This is a brief overview of the two kinds of scheduling and their directions in the table below:

FORWARD BACKWARD
Normal Scheduling
(One or more orders)
Starts by scheduling the first operation of each order. All subsequent operations are scheduled after each other on the best resource according to the scheduling strategy. Start by scheduling the last operation of each order. All operations prior to the last operations are scheduled in reverse order, ensuring no operation ends after the next operation starts. Operations are placed on the best resource according to the scheduling strategy.
Bottleneck sort
(One or more operations)
Lock operations selected in the gantt chart. All subsequent operations after the locked operations are scheduled after each other according to the scheduling strategy. Lock operations selected in the gantt chart. All operations in sequence before the locked operations are scheduled in reverse order according to the scheduling strategy.

NOTE: Bottleneck sort can can be done in both forward and backward direction at the same time!

Scheduling Orders

Scheduling orders in ROB-EX can be done in several ways:

  • By setting the state of an order from new to planned in the Order List.
  • By selecting one or more orders in the Order List pressing the “Replan order” button.
  • By selecting one or more operations in the gantt chart:

How the orders and operations are scheduled is controlled by a Scheduling strategy and scheduling settings on the resources.
